30% of Mr. Ken's paycheck goes toward taxes. If he made $1800 on his last paycheck, how much money went towards his taxes

Respuesta :

abbyferguson16p5vb0r abbyferguson16p5vb0r
  • 02-12-2020

Answer:

$540

Step-by-step explanation:

$1800 x 30% = 540
